What Influences Stowe Vacation Rental Prices?

Several factors significantly impact the cost of renting a vacation property in Stowe:

  • Time of Year: Peak season (winter for skiing, summer for hiking and foliage) commands the highest prices. Shoulder seasons (spring and fall) offer more moderate rates. Expect the highest prices during major holidays like Christmas, New Year's, and Thanksgiving.

  • Property Type and Size: A cozy studio apartment will be considerably cheaper than a sprawling luxury chalet with multiple bedrooms and bathrooms. Amenities like hot tubs, fireplaces, and private pools also increase costs.

  • Location: Properties closer to Stowe Mountain Resort or within walking distance of town will generally be more expensive than those situated further afield. Proximity to hiking trails, scenic views, and other attractions also plays a significant role.

  • Amenities: As mentioned above, the level of amenities significantly influences pricing. Think about features like fully equipped kitchens, high-speed internet, laundry facilities, and outdoor spaces.

  • Demand: Stowe is a popular destination. High demand during peak seasons leads to increased prices. Booking early is always recommended to secure your preferred property and the best rates.

How Much Will a Stowe Vacation Rental Cost in 2026?

Predicting exact pricing for 2026 is challenging. However, based on current trends and historical data, we can offer some general estimates:

  • Budget-Friendly Options: Expect to find smaller studios or one-bedroom apartments for around $150-$300 per night during the shoulder seasons and $300-$500+ during peak season.

  • Mid-Range Properties: Two- to three-bedroom homes or condos with standard amenities might range from $300-$600 per night during the shoulder seasons and $600-$1200+ during peak season.

  • Luxury Rentals: High-end properties with premium amenities, spacious layouts, and prime locations could cost upwards of $1000 per night, even more during peak periods. These can reach several thousand dollars per night during peak holiday weeks.

Remember: These are estimates, and actual prices can vary widely depending on the specific property, its features, and the booking platform used.

What is the best time to book a Stowe vacation rental for 2026?

To secure the best selection and potentially lower rates, booking well in advance is recommended, especially if traveling during peak season. Ideally, start searching and booking as early as possible, perhaps even a year ahead, for the most popular times.

How can I find the best value for my Stowe vacation rental?

Comparing prices across multiple websites, considering shoulder seasons, looking at properties slightly outside the immediate town center, and booking early will all help you get the best value.
